Transaction 2cf2d2afa0d434eb2ff264fdfcb7bd618fe1043028fc2acb809adf06056cde81
1 Input
1 Outputs
- 2cf2d2afa0d434eb2ff264fdfcb7bd618fe1043028fc2acb809adf06056cde81:0
value 5246204
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G